Frequently Asked Questions

What's the best robot mower under $2,500?
The Mammotion LUBA 2 AWD 3000X ($2,499) is the best overall pick under $2,500. It has AWD with 80% slope rating, 4G cellular, and 0.75-acre capacity. For properties with tree cover, the Dreame A3 AWD Pro ($2,499) is the better pick thanks to its LiDAR navigation.
Is the LUBA 2 AWD 3000X worth $2,499?
Yes — it's the best-selling AWD robot mower on Amazon for good reason. The AWD with 80% slope rating, 4G cellular for anti-theft, and 0.75-acre capacity make it the most well-rounded pick at this price.
What's the best robot mower under $2,500 for flat lawns?
For flat lawns, the Segway Navimow i110N ($1,499) is a better value than the $2,499 options. Save the $1,000 unless you specifically need AWD for slopes or LiDAR for tree cover.
